zoukankan      html  css  js  c++  java
  • thinkphp api架构搭建

    1.结构搭建

       模块下面使用 controller , model ,service,validate分别对应的作用

              controller控制器里面可以进行分版本 v1,v2之类的,不过要访问通必须配置对应的路由规则

             model 模型层进行一些数据处理 比如获取关联的数据等 可以使用hasMany

            service一般用于处理一些业务逻辑该层既可以和controller合并也可以单独使用

           validate 用于验证传输过来的参数 里面的类继承validate类

     exception异常处理可以重写异常处理类,需要在config.php文件中进行配置exception_handle为自己的类

    extra目录用于配置一些公共问题文件可以通过 config函数调用
  • 相关阅读:
    作业16
    递归函数
    三元表达式与生成式
    迭代器与生成器
    作业15
    装饰器
    作业14
    string的入门与进阶
    修理牧场(优先队列)
    旅游规划
  • 原文地址:https://www.cnblogs.com/lglblogadd/p/9516047.html
Copyright © 2011-2022 走看看